Cyberpunk's Improvement Timeline

To calm gamers down, the co-founder of the company recorded a video message to passionate users. In the video, he confidently states that the company aimed to create a game that would remain a legacy for a long time.

He is very pleased with how the game turned out on PC and sincerely apologizes for the different situation on consoles. He did not admit that the problem exists on all consoles, but he said that the company is striving to eliminate all bugs in the near future.

Following the message, the developers published a plan that the company's programmers will follow and work on. In early 2021, we can expect two major updates for Cyberpunk. Additionally, the company guarantees continuous work on minor bugs throughout the year.

The CEO also shared DLC news with gamers. The first half of 2021 promises a free patch for the game, but the exact date is still unknown.

The second half of the year promises a free upgrade for new consoles.
